Start with a story. It could be your story, or the story of someone whose life you changed. Describe what you do. This is your mission statement. Benefits. Describe your demographics. Create an advisory board. Ask for the money. Promise deliverables. Don't sell yourself short.
Step 1: Realise you already have what brands want. Step 2: Get to know your audience. Step 3: Create a media kit. Step 4: Choose brands that fit. Step 5: Stay authentic.
Some Important Things to Remember when Drafting your Sponsorship Letter are: Structure your letter properly: Mention your sponsorship letters purpose: Explain what it is worth to your sponsor to help you: Thank them: Proofread and edit your sponsorship letter: Follow up personally:

Put your sponsor logos (with a link and short description of the company) on your website. Create a sponsor graphic with all sponsor logos for your website and for social media. Mention sponsors in press releases.
Always address the person by name if you can find it. Look hard for it. Introduce yourself. Add a compliment relating to their business. Ask for sponsorship. Tell them what they will get out of it. Tell them why you are doing it. Don't assume they will sponsor you. Close nicely.
Step 1: Open your letter with a professional header. Step 2: Describe yourself or your organization. Step 3: Explain how a sponsor's support of you is beneficial to them. Step 4: Write a closing paragraph.
